Are you a fluent Igbo speaker based in Purfleet or nearby areas, looking to make a difference in your community? We are currently recruiting Igbo Interpreters to join our growing network of professional linguists. Whether you're an experienced qualified interpreter seeking more assignments or starting your career as a freelance interpreter, this opportunity is ideal for you.

We are a leading UK-based provider of face-to-face, telephone, and video remote interpreting services, working with NHS Trusts, local councils, law firms, insurance companies, and private clients across the UK.

Why Join Us?

  • Flexible working hours 24/7 – accept assignments that fit your schedule
  • Opportunities for both remote interpreting and in-person appointments
  • Supportive and professional team
  • Competitive pay rates
  • Work that makes a real impact in your local community

Typical Assignments Include:

  • NHS hospitals and GP practices
  • Social services and child protection
  • Schools and educational settings
  • Solicitor appointments and court hearings
  • Housing and council departments
  • Private sector consultations

Requirements

  • Fluency in English and at least one other language
  • Right to work in the UK
  • Professional interpreting qualifications
  • Enhanced DBS certificate (or willingness to apply)
  • Professional references
  • Proof of ID and address

We welcome applicants with a community interpreting qualification, DPSI, NRPSI registration, or relevant experience in the field.
